Besides a well-stocked bird feeder, what habitat element helps keep cardinals fed year-round?

Answer

A healthy, natural habitat with native shrubs and undisturbed ground cover.

Because cardinals employ an integrated feeding approach—using both high perches for seeds and low-level foraging for insects—the surrounding environment is crucial. A natural habitat that includes abundant native shrubs, mulch, and undisturbed ground cover directly supports their essential insect hunting activities, making this habitat just as important as providing supplemental seeds at a dedicated feeder for their year-round nutritional requirements.
